What is Ship-to-Patron and who can use it?

The library will ship items that can be borrowed to CU student, faculty, and staff members who live at least 45 minutes from CU.

How do I make a request?

If you need an item shipped, please fill out this form or contact the library at library@carolinau.edu.

How do I get my item?

If the item is available, the library will retrieve the item, check it out to the patron, and have it shipped to the patron’s address.

What does it cost?

Our shipping service is free for patrons. The library will cover the postage to send items to the patron and the postage to return items to the library.

What else do I need to know?

  • The patron must allow the library 24 hours from the time of the request, not including Saturdays and days closed, to prepare the item to ship.
  • The Manuel Library cannot handle international shipping.
  • The standard checkout period is 7 weeks.
  • Exceptions will be made on a case-by-case basis for patrons with disabilities.
